Dysregulation of the PRUNE2/PCA3 genetic axis in human prostate cancer: From experimental discovery to validation in two independent patient cohorts
2022-10-30
Abstract excerpt
<h4>BACKGROUND</h4> We have previously shown that the long non-coding (lnc)RNA prostate cancer associated 3 ( PCA3 ; formerly prostate cancer antigen 3 ) functions as a trans-dominant negative oncogene by targeting the previously unrecognized prostate cancer suppressor gene PRUNE2 (a homolog of the Drosophila prune gene), thereby forming a functional unit within a unique allelic locus in human cells.
